At around 5:50am on Friday, shots were fired in the direction of the monitored houses from the Azerbaijani positions located near Karmir Shuka and Taghavard villages of the Martuni region of Artsakh (Nagorno-Karabakh). Artsakh Republic (AR) Human Rights Defender (Ombudsman) Gegham Stepanyan wrote about this on Facebook. He added as follows, in particular:
"It is noteworthy that the described incident was another manifestation of the regular intensified terrorist acts by the Azerbaijani armed forces in recent days.
The AR Human Rights Defender reiterates that the Azerbaijani armed bases located near the peaceful settlements of Artsakh and the Armenophobic and terrorist acts being carried out through them are a direct and indisputable threat to the rights of the population of Artsakh—in particular, to the right to life.
I reaffirm the assertion that the criminal acts being carried out by Azerbaijan are of a regular and systematic nature, which is aimed at creating a climate of fear, despair in Artsakh.
Azerbaijan will continue its criminal attempts directed against the people of Artsakh until the international community unanimously condemns the blatant Azerbaijani illegalities directed against humanity."
